Output 867251e0cac6b9ec56608399bce0b26909df9e214b097a4cded6fbeee36a4209:31

value
3830908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e7c630155f72999698465e0f40e37679c43eb1 OP_EQUAL
address
3HBPmv1k6VG58ieH31gffCGxDMqpMkML63
transaction
867251e0cac6b9ec56608399bce0b26909df9e214b097a4cded6fbeee36a4209
spent
true